Mind Flayer earns its DeePuff fit from 24% THC, a chill evening profile led by Limonene, and effects that lean calmer and more body-forward.
As _Dungeons & Dragons_ lore has it, a Mind Flayer (an illithid) is a brilliant humanoid monster with an octopus-like head and long tentacles. Thankfully, as bred by Solfire Gardens, the Mind Flayer strain is a much more delightful creature with no known malevolent effects. Mind Flayer is a balanced hybrid developed from a cross of Double Tap and Why U Gelly strains. You'll get hints of sweet and sour candy on the inhale and an undeniably fruit-forward aroma. Despite what you may assume by the name Mind Flayer, this is a relaxing and giggly strain that's highly sociable. So, it pairs well with a long night of D & D.

Actual Delivered Dose
Mind Flayer is 24% THC, but combustion + first-pass loss eat most of it. Here's what reaches your bloodstream.
Total THC in dose: 72 mg
Sources
Joint / Blunt: Combustion + sidestream loss; ~63–73% destroyed (Pomahacova 2009).
Bong: Cooler combustion, less sidestream; ~50–60% retained.
Dry-Herb Vape: Volcano studies show ~55–80% delivery at 180–210°C (Hazekamp 2006).
Dab / Concentrate: Pre-decarbed extract; quartz-banger 500°F (Raber 2015).
Edible: High first-pass hepatic loss; 4–20% bioavailability (Lucas 2018).
Sublingual / Oil: Bypasses some first-pass; 13–35% bioavailable.

What are Terpenes?
Terpenes are aromatic compounds found in cannabis that contribute to each strain's unique smell, taste, and effects. They work synergistically with cannabinoids in what's known as the "entourage effect" to enhance or modify the overall experience.
